26250007


Engine Mounting (Green)


D=Ø110 h=120


1496288 ; 1423011 ; 1336885 ; 1778530 ; 




SCANIA

TO GET A QUOTE:


SHARE THIS PRODUCT ON SOCIAL MEDIA:

Related Products